Veracruzana’s Still Great

We remember back when Taqueria La Veracruzana opened. It was late 2001 and we had just moved to Philadelphia from New York. All we wanted were some traditional, Mexican tacos—the kind that come in soft corn tortillas and are garnished with not much more than cilantro and radish on the side. But we couldn’t find them without a trip to deep North Philly. We were crushed.

Don’t get us wrong… There were some places serving quality American-style tacos. But we wanted more than shredded yellow cheddar cheese and iceberg lettuce.

Than Veracruzana opened and they were just a few blocks away from our apartment in South Philly. We were happy.
